Unicoil’s cold rolled mill construction is near by
Unicoil which is the first Saudi Arabian company to manufacture prepainted steel products, is planning to construct a cold rolled mill.
However, the mill's building contractors have not been decided upon yet. Unicoil is going to select either Italian steel equipment maker Danieli or Voest-Alpine Industrieanlagenbau (VAI) of
Austria. The final details of offers and the mill's requirements are still being discussed between Unicoil and the building contractors. Also, the project's scale and investment cost are part of the on going negotiations.
Unicoil stated that the company will have to make the final decision in two or three weeks due to offers valid date will be end of June.
The mill's
production is scheduled to initiate in 2005. After the
construction, the new cold rolled mill will have between 250'000-400'000 tons of annual capacity. Furthermore, the 60% of cold rolled are being
galvanized in order to supply the requirements of Unicoil's painting line which is located in Al-Jubail, east coast of Saudi Arabia with an annual capacity of 120'000 tons. The balance 40% is sold to the market.
